当前位置:首页 > 行业动态 > 正文

怎么查看云服务器进程信息

可以通过SSH登录云服务器,然后使用命令 ps -aux查看进程信息。也可以使用监控工具如top、htop等。

在云计算时代,云服务器已经成为了许多企业和个人的首选,对于一些初学者来说,如何查看云服务器的进程可能会成为一个难题,本文将详细介绍如何在各种操作系统中查看云服务器的进程,帮助大家更好地理解和管理自己的云服务器。

Linux系统下的进程查看

1、使用ps命令

ps命令是Linux系统中最常用的进程查看命令,它可以显示当前运行的进程信息,基本语法如下:

ps aux

这个命令会显示所有用户的进程信息,包括进程ID、用户、CPU占用率、内存占用率、虚拟内存、常驻内存、进程状态和启动时间等。

2、使用top命令

top命令可以实时显示系统的动态进程信息,包括进程ID、用户、CPU占用率、内存占用率等,基本语法如下:

top

在top界面中,可以使用以下按键进行操作:

q:退出top命令;

h:显示帮助信息;

k:杀死某个进程;

r:重新调整进程优先级;

f:切换显示字段。

Windows系统下的进程查看

1、使用任务管理器

任务管理器是Windows系统中最常用的进程查看工具,可以通过以下方式打开:

右键点击任务栏,选择“任务管理器”;

按下Ctrl+Shift+Esc组合键;

按下Ctrl+Alt+Delete组合键,然后选择“任务管理器”。

在任务管理器中,可以看到当前运行的进程、性能、应用和启动项等信息,可以通过“详细信息”选项卡查看更详细的进程信息。

2、使用命令提示符

在Windows系统中,还可以通过命令提示符查看进程信息,按下Win+R组合键,输入cmd,然后按下回车键,在命令提示符中,可以使用以下命令查看进程信息:

tasklist:显示当前运行的进程列表;

taskkill:结束某个进程;

tskill:结束某个窗口进程。

Mac系统下的进程查看

1、使用活动监视器

活动监视器是Mac系统中常用的进程查看工具,可以通过以下方式打开:

点击屏幕底部的Dock栏中的“实用工具”文件夹,找到并打开“活动监视器”;

按下Cmd+Space组合键,然后输入“活动监视器”并回车。

在活动监视器中,可以看到当前运行的进程、CPU占用率、内存占用率等信息,可以通过“日志”选项卡查看更详细的进程信息。

2、使用终端

在Mac系统中,还可以通过终端查看进程信息,点击屏幕顶部的“前往”菜单,选择“实用工具”,然后找到并打开“终端”,在终端中,可以使用以下命令查看进程信息:

ps A:显示所有用户的进程列表;

top:实时显示系统的动态进程信息;

killall [进程名]:结束某个进程。

其他注意事项

1、查看进程时,请注意保护个人隐私和敏感信息,避免泄露给不相关的人员。

2、在结束进程时,请确保了解该进程的作用和影响,避免误杀重要进程导致系统或应用无法正常运行。

3、如果发现某个进程占用资源过高或异常,可以尝试重启相关服务或应用,或者寻求专业人士的帮助。

4、定期查看和管理系统进程,有助于优化系统性能和提高安全性。

相关问题与解答:

1、Q:如何查看云服务器的CPU和内存占用情况?

A:可以使用Linux系统的top命令或Windows系统的任务管理器查看CPU和内存占用情况,在Mac系统中,可以使用活动监视器或终端查看相关信息。

2、Q:如何结束一个正在运行的进程?

A:在Linux系统中,可以使用kill命令结束一个进程;在Windows系统中,可以使用任务管理器或命令提示符的taskkill命令;在Mac系统中,可以使用终端的killall命令,需要注意的是,结束进程前请确保了解该进程的作用和影响。

3、Q:如何优化云服务器的性能?

A:优化云服务器性能的方法有很多,例如升级硬件配置、优化系统设置、清理无用文件和应用、限制不必要的后台进程等,具体方法需要根据服务器的实际情况进行分析和调整。

0